Read Ahead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 1,320,384 | 1,314,462 | 5,922 | 7.8 | 68% |
| 2012 | 1,359,308 | 1,233,420 | 125,888 | 9.6 | 63% |
| 2013 | 1,001,220 | 1,220,611 | −219,391 | 7.5 | 65% |
| 2014 | 883,123 | 1,138,747 | −255,624 | 5.4 | 58% |
| 2015 | 1,111,615 | 1,077,593 | 34,022 | 6.0 | 63% |
| 2016 | 1,061,230 | 1,009,637 | 51,593 | 7.1 | 63% |
| 2017 | 1,234,265 | 1,226,693 | 7,572 | 5.9 | 63% |
| 2018 | 1,350,055 | 1,270,090 | 79,965 | 6.4 | 63% |
| 2019 | 1,399,583 | 1,357,931 | 41,652 | 6.4 | 61% |
| 2020 | 1,569,537 | 1,518,084 | 51,453 | 6.1 | 66% |
| 2021 | 1,955,834 | 1,741,468 | 214,366 | 6.8 | 60% |
| 2022 | 1,784,961 | 1,727,925 | 57,036 | 7.3 | 61% |
| 2023 | 1,915,316 | 1,859,066 | 56,250 | 7.1 | 55% |
In its most recent public year (2023), this organization brought in $56,250 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 7.1 months of spending. Staff pay was 55% of spending.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023.
